NTSB Narrative Summary Released at Completion of Accident

The airplane was observed maneuvering low along highway 601, buzzing a worker on a tractor. While maneuvering the airplane collided with two transmission lines. It appeared that the pilot applied full power and the airplane pitched up dramatically. The power lines became tangled around the left wing, the airplane rolled over inverted, came over the top and collided with the ground. The post-accident examination of the airplane revealed that all flight control surfaces were attached, and there was continuity on all flight controls surfaces. Post-accident examination of the airplane did not reveal any mechanical failure.

NTSB Probable Cause Narrative

The pilots failure to maintain adequate clearance from object and inadequate visual look-out while maneuvering resulted in an in-flight collision with power lines.
